2020 was different. Not necessarily bad. I think a lot of people have used the time to think and started doing things for which they usually cannot find time. Many people became creative and discovered the music for themselves or any other kind of art during the lockdown.

​Musicians may even have found the time to finally record and release their first songs. 
I think this year was an opportunity for all newcomers as the major labels have withheld some of their releases.

Newcomers have had the chance to be heard and included in playlists, where normally only the stars can be found. Apart from that it was largely business as usual. Since the artists could not tour other new possibilities have proved successful. New music platforms were discovered, streaming concerts have become established and there were a lot of possibilities to earn money without touring. 

So, did 2020 ruin music? I don´t think so. It´s very sad that there are no concerts at the moment, but the music business continues and flourishes again through the many newcomers and new opportunities!
​
Crazy times but I think a lot have started to live their dream as a musician and – thank god – nobody made a COVID-anthem. 
Livia Veser - Artist Manager Claudia eRecords / Germany
